A wonderful place to spend some quality time in nature. We took our four-year old and had so much fun walking the trails, enjoying the sunshine, and meeting some animals. We spread out a blanket near the water and stared up at the clouds for a while too. On our way out, we saw some ladies spinning wool that was harvested from the sheep at the park! This is something that the group does once a month, together, at the visitor center. Our little girl loved spinning the yarn (with help of course). The only thing that would make this place better is more animals :) The animals that were there were clearly well taken care of and loved. The park is very clean and well-maintained. Ample parking on a beautiful Saturday too. Keep up the great work!

It's perfect for a relaxing day out. The trails are well-maintained, and the boardwalks are great for birdwatching. I even spotted a bald eagle when I was there! Don't miss the National Colonial Farm; it's so cool to see the heritage animals and learn about the area's history. Overall, I'd say it's a fantastic spot for a quiet picnic and a leisurely walk. The blend of nature and history makes it a really special place. I highly recommend it for a peaceful day trip.
